## Tuning

The Hollowmere sweeper deletes expired records in bounded batches. Deletion is idempotent; tombstones persist one full cycle for audit. Batch size, scan interval, and grace windows are the only security-relevant knobs. Lower grace windows reduce exposure; higher ones aid recovery. All are read at startup only. Current production values follow.

tuning table, yajog-yahof:
BUDGETS = {
    "lamvan": 303,
    "wenox": 460,
    "fenvan": 525,
}

## Digest Scheduling

Batch email digests on Pellwick run via the Cramhorn scheduler, every six hours. Edit cadence in digest.yaml only; never trigger sends manually in production. Dry-run first with the staging flag. Scheduler calls require authenticating against the internal Mablet queue service. Configure your client with the key that follows.

API key for yahig-tadup: kto7_ubizbYm

MEMO — Kettling Depot Receiving

Uniform sets for the new Kettling depot arrive Wednesday via Ashgrove courier: 40 boxes, sorted by size, manifest attached to box one. Check the count at the dock before signing; shortages go straight to stores, not the courier. The hand-over instruction the courier will follow is set out below.

drop instructions, tafof-baguf: the holmir gilox courier leaves the sormir ulaok holdor ledger at gate 5596 under passcode 257343

## Environment variables — Tailwick internal log-tailing CLI

Tailwick streams logs from our Hollowpine aggregator to engineer workstations. From a security standpoint, note that `TAILWICK_REDACT=on` is enforced at the server and cannot be disabled client-side; `TAILWICK_RETENTION_HINT` is advisory only. Sessions are read-only and scoped per team. Every audit-relevant action is logged server-side with the caller's identity. The CLI authenticates with a short-lived token, which the env file declares on the line that follows.

env line for kawef-bajop: VAULT_KEY13=bcea803fc73c3

## Deployment

Periodo, the timetable solver for the Hallbrook school district, ships as a single container. Build the image with the standard Makefile target and push it to the internal registry. The solver needs roughly 2 GB of memory per scheduling run, so size the node pool accordingly. Before starting the service, set the following configuration values in your environment.

settings of yahig-baweg:
[istael]
host = istael.qorvellabs.corp
user = istael_svc
database = istael_prod